Women who have not had menstruation over the age of 18, or who have had normal menstruation but have stopped for more than 3 months, are said to have amenorrhea. Amenorrhea is very harmful to women and may even cause infertility. The cause must be identified and symptomatic treatment must be given in a timely manner, supplemented by dietary adjustments.
